Stomach Pains: Food Poisoning or Just a Tummy Ache?
Close the picnic blanket! According to the CDC, about 76 million people are affected by food-borne illnesses each year, with more than 300,000 requiring hospitalization. Children are especially susceptible to the nasty bugs because their immune systems are still developing. Popular Summer activities like picnics, beach days, and camping trips can increase the chances of contracting an illness due to the combination of heat and improper food handling.
